Hours after Donald Trump was laughed at for bragging in front of world leaders, the President of Iran, Hassan Rouhani, stood at the podium in front of world leaders at the United Nations and said of Trump, without calling him by name:
“It is unfortunate that we are witnessing rulers in the world who think they can… gain popular support through the fomenting of extremist nationalism and racism and through xenophobic tendencies resembling a Nazi disposition.”
Earlier in the day, Donald Trump was speaking to the assembly when he elicited a first, world leaders laughed at him. From The Washington Post.
“The embarrassing exchange came when Trump boasted that his administration had accomplished more over two years than “almost any administration” in American history, eliciting audible guffaws in the cavernous chamber hall.The president appeared startled. “Didn’t expect that reaction,” he said, “but that’s okay.”“He has always been obsessed that people are laughing at the president. From the mid-’80s, he’s said: ‘The world is laughing at us. They think we’re fools,’ ” said Thomas Wright, a Europe analyst at the Brookings Institution. “It’s never been true, but he’s said it about every president. It’s the first time I’m aware of that people actually laughed at a president. I think it is going to drive him absolutely crazy. It will play to every insecurity he has.”
